Lester Charles Livingood
August 17th, 1922 - May 30th, 2019
Lester Charles Livingood passed away May 30, 2019 in Olympia, Washington. He was born August 17, 1922 to Charles and Esther Livingood in Detroit Lakes, Minnesota. Lester completed his eighth grade education (age 13) in a one-room school house in Detroit Lakes. He attended Sig C Bell Telephone school while in the Air Force, attended an agricultural school on the GI Bill, and then Bates Auto Mechanic School. He served in the 4135th Army Air Force Base Unit from October 1942 to 1945 as an occupation telephone lineman. He was involved in battles and campaigns in Naples and Rome, and received several decorations, including an American Theater Ribbon, European-African-Middle Eastern Ribbon with two bronze stars, Victory Medal, and Good Conduct Medal. Lester worked hard his whole life, starting at age eight by driving a tractor on the family farm. After the service, he raised milk cows and farmed in Detroit Lakes for five years. He had a Mobil Station in Olivia, Minnesota, followed by a Mobil Station in Olympia. He owned/operated Livingood Auto Repair and Tractor Rental in Lacey, Washington. In the 1970s, he started mail routes, which he did for 20 years. Lester had a great sense of humor. He loved being outdoors, and enjoyed hunting, fishing, and mowing his lawn. He loved playing cards with family, and traveling around America in his motorhome. He was a member of Gloria Dei Lutheran Church in Olympia. He is survived by his sons, Ronald Livingood and Richard Livingood; daughters, Lana Bluhm, Barbara Connelly, and Betty Livingood; 11 grandchildren; 13 great grandchildren; brother, Harlan Livingood; and sisters, Charlene Johnson and Marlys Brahmer. He was predeceased by his parents; wife, Donna L. (Johnson) Livingood (1/23/2011); son, Charles Livingood; brothers, Edwin, Curt, Dean, Leonard and Dale; and sisters, Gladys, Myrtle, Vernes, and Alice.
